Teton Valley is centrally located to some of the best fishing spots in the country. Teton River, Snake River, Swan Valley, Jackson Hole, Henry’s Fork, Ashton, and Island Park are all meccas for people who love to fish in some of the most scenic and iconic rivers in the world. The Snake River alone is a fishing dream with more than 5,000 trout per mile and a daily average of 15- to 18-inch Yellowstone Cutthroat, Rainbow, Cutbows and Brown Trout. The South Fork starts with nymph fishing in early May, then transitions to dry fly fishing by the end of June and through October.

#1: Teton Valley Lodge 

Located in the heart of Teton Valley, Teton Valley Lodge guided fishing services can take you to more than 25 different sections of river fishing on three blue ribbon fisheries. At six thousand feet above sea-level, Henry’s Fork flows out of a spring created by volcanic activity more than a millennium ago. The South Fork of the Snake provides gorgeous scenery, up-close wildlife experiences, and enough trout to fill any fly fisherman’s net. The Teton has so many different types of water, from spring creek to rushing rapids. This Eastern Idaho fly fishing lodge has been family owned and operated for four generations. #5: South Fork Lodge

South Fork Lodge rests on the banks of the best dry-fly trout fishery in America — the South Fork of the Snake River. The South Fork flows from the bottom of Palisades Reservoir, about 12 miles from the lodge to its confluence with the fabled Henry’s Fork, some 62 river miles away.
